  • Specifications

    Model

    H-40

    Control Method

    Digital embedded control software

    Working Mode

    Manual mode, automatic mode, and temperature control mode.

    Current Heating Setting

    5 sections (can be extended to 32)

    Input voltage

    3phase 380V 50/60Hz

    Rated current

    40A

    Maximum current

    64A

    Rated power output

    25KW

    Max output power

    40KW

    Frequency

    10-60KHz

    Power range

    2-100%

    Cooling water flow

    12.5L/min

    Max inlet water temperature

    35°C

    Cooling water PH value

    7.0-9.0

    Generator dimension

    652 x463 x 618mm

    Generator weight

    63kg

    Transformer dimension

    120x280x240mm

    Transformer weight

    29kg

    Control Method: Digital embedded control software.

    Main Chip: ARM STM32.

    Chip Speed: 72MHz

    Working Mode: Manual mode, automatic mode, and temperature control mode.

    Current Heating Setting: 5 sections (can be extended to 32).

    Number of Working Parameter Storage: 10 pcs/mode.

    Display Screen: 3.5 inches True Color display screen, resolution ratio 320*240.

    Communication & Start-up Interface: DB-9 and 4 cores air plug.

    Bus Access: RS485 (recommended), Profibus (optional), CANbus (optional).

    Trial Function Time: 200 hours. (While the trial function enables, the device will be locked down when it reaches the setting time.).

    The composing of the handheld induction heaters:

    1. All-digital handheld induction heater

    2. Robotic arm (coaxial soft cable and the handheld part)

    3. Inductor

    4. Water cooling system(optional)

  • Main Characteristics

    1. Digital Signal Processing relize the heating curve programming. Heating time can be accurate to 0.1 second. Implement a variety of operating parameters. Can store equipment operation parameters.

    2. Quick and easy to use, accurate and repeatable and consistent heat transfer performance increase productitity.

    3. No flame, no gas, and no heat, make the operator more comfortable.

    4. Portable mobility and applications of multifunctional heating allows relization of all kinds of tasks.

    5. Efficient and precise heating process means getting things done at a time.

    6. Adopt digital control software, IGBT module and Inverting technologies of Fourth generation, Higher reliability and lower maintenance cost.

    7. 100% Duty cycle, continuous working is allowed at maximum power output.

    8. Working Model: Manual, Auto, and temperature control.

    9. Working condition display: time, current, frequency, current curve.

    10. Alarm interface: over current, over voltage, water lack, phase false, over heat and so on.

    11. Heating head’s leading wire is 3-5 meters long, suitable for welding, heat the work piece that normal machine cannot reach to it.

  • Typical Applications

    Air conditioning, refrigerator freezer, refrigeration valve pipe pieces, solar accessories, compressor, compressor parts, washing machine, tube and pipe connections with the casing connection, pipe and valve connection, auto parts in the evaporator and the compressor connection, etc.
